CTM Festival's 18th edition took place from 27 January – 5 February 2017 in various Berlin venues including HAU – Hebbel am Ufer, Berghain, YAAM, Heimathafen Neukölln, SchwuZ, and Kunstraum Kreuzberg/Bethanien.

Under the title Fear Anger Love CTM 2017 focused explicitly on radical forms of musical expression and dissonant emotions found in or through music and examined the diverse strategies that are applied to unleash or harness them.

Over 250 artists and professionals from 32 different countries contributed to over 150 performances and projects that made up the CTM 2017 programme, which also included the premiere of five commissioned works, two of which were supported through the CTM 2017 Radio Lab. The 8-day Transfer programme encompassed the Discourse series of artist talks and film screenings, the 5th edition of the collaborative MusicMaker’s Hacklab for music technology, a Research Networking Day rebooted through guest curation by Dahlia Borsche (Humboldt University's Department of Musicology), a Meet & Greet for Collaborative Networks, a Network Speed Dating session, and the CTM exhibition, curated by Carlos Prieto Acevedo, which focused on music and sound art in Mexico. 

As always, the CTM festival was held in parallel to and in collaboration with transmediale – festival for art and digital culture which took place at the Haus der Kulturen der Welt. CTM and transmediale also hosted the P2P Vorspiel initiative together with over 35 local venues and organisations and launched with an opening event on 20 January at ACUD Macht Neu.
